Folk singer Andreana Čekić openly spoke about her difficult relationship with her father. For a period of her life, she had no contact with him, which was very hard for her. When they finally met after several years, her father did not recognize her, which was very painful. Andreana described feeling nervous and wanting to hug him, but she did not feel the love she expected. She also highlighted that her parents had a bad separation and she witnessed their insults, which left deep emotional scars. Despite everything, there was no violence, but the pain she feels continues to this day.
